Seedcamp Launches a European Version of AngelList

European startup incubator Seedcamp has launched a new online platform, Seedsummit.org, aimed at connecting startups with European seed investors. An attempt to create a European version of the incredibly successful AngelList, plans for the website grew out of the Seedsummit conference last year, along with the recognition that Europe needed a "stronger more cohesive network to support enrepreneurs."

Seedcamp has expanded geographically this year, with Mini-Seedcamps globally. Seedcamp notes that none of these areas have "the density of either the VC or angel money available in the Valley," but hopes that the efforts of Seedsummit.org will help to build the emerging groups of investors in some of these markets into which the incubator has expanded.

The investors on Seedsummit.org are qualified, says Seedcamp, they're active in seed and they're looking for deals. The site has a dedicated space for both investors and entrepreneurs, the latter containing some funding guides and documents. The site plans to add more features soon.

As Mike Butcher points out, it's worth noting that "this is not an independent media outfit - Seedcamp has skin in the game itself. It also means any Angel on the list - including Seedcamp - will see any deal pasing through the site." But as the site will help to strengthen the investor and entrepreneur networks in Europe, it is still a worthwhile effort.
